Poland (Marguerite) and Hammond-Tooke (David)

THE ABUNDANT HERDS (Sponsors' Edition Specimen Copy)

A Celebration of the Nguni Cattle of the Zulu People.

Published: Fernwood Press, Cape Town, 2003

Artwork by Leigh Voigt.

144 pages, pictorial title page and many colour plates and illustrations throughout, an additional specially printed plate is tipped onto the second front free endpaper signed by the artist, bound in full brown morocco by Peter Carstens with a gilt vignette on the upper cover, titled gilt on the spine, housed in a mauve cloth slip case with a plate sunk illustration, a fine copy.

Sponsors' Edition: A special edition limited to 26 copies. Unnumbered Specimen Copy presented to Fernwood Press (Pty.) Limited signed by Marguerite Poland, David Hammond-Took and Leigh Voight.

Nguni cattle are of economic, social, political and spiritual importance to the Zulu people and they, and cattle relate imagery play a significant role in the Zulu oral tradition. The well being of the herds and the well being of humans are so closely connected that cattle have become part of the spiritual and aesthetic lives of the people – a perception that has given rise to a complex, and poetic naming practice.
